I bought this to replace the front brake pads on a 2013 Audi S4. It wasn't clear to me how to use it properly, so I tried several ways: 1) - Open it up and use the insides to squeeze the plunger and close the expander. It would work if it could open further, but it barely opens enough to fit when the brakes are almost fully retracted. 2)- Close it and use the outsides to push the plunger and open the expander. It worked, but the piston, by design, pushed unevenly. Also confusing is that you can mount the head on the piston side (limiting the opening to half a turn) or vice versa. medium and more practical, I spent too much time figuring out how to use it. I also wanted to use it to remove the retaining spring by squeezing it, but it didn't open far enough.
